Tony
this happens as Napatech is doing something smart to collapse packets together into a single PCI transfer, so that we put less stress on the PCIe bus and thus we can avoid having two controllers and moreover a pcap file per device.

Tory,
we have recorders that do 20G to disk, If you use Intel NICs you need to use 2 n2disk instances that write to 2 partitions (hence youi need two controllers). With Napatech cards you can save everything onto the same partition. Note that in the first case, our extraction tools merge the two ports packets, whereas on the second case a dumped pcap is already "ready to use". For 10G you need at least 8x10K RPM SATA drives (10 are better).

Hi Tory
N2disk works on OSX but for 10g you need to use Linux. We know people who have tried thunderbolt and the outcome is that the performance is suboptimal (I have seen a report during the sharkfest conference) so I think OSX is not yet a viable alternative to Linux both in performance and price
